Batten down the hatches!
After a night of heavy rain, we can expect a day of stiff winds along the coast of Lake Huron and Georgian Bay.
Bayshore Broadcasting Weather Specialist John Wilson says most of the rain has already fallen, but a deep low pressure system is settling in.
Wilson says winds will likely blow around 60 kilometres an hour with stronger gusts closer to the lake.
He says the wind may not be as strong inland, but you can still expect to be blown around a bit.
And of course, Wilson is predicting rain off and on throughout the day, so bring an umbrella and make sure you’ve got a firm grip!
